Job Description
Technical Lead
CrewBloom
- Team Leadership & Mentorship: Act as the primary technical guide for a team of developers, designers, and product managers. You will foster a collaborative environment, provide constructive feedback, and help team members grow. - Stakeholder Communication: Translate complex technical requirements into clear, actionable insights for non-technical stakeholders and founders. You will be the "bridge" that ensures everyone is aligned on the product roadmap. - Strategic Decision Making: Participate in high-level discussions regarding the app’s architecture, feature set, and long-term scalability. You will be responsible for choosing the right tools and methods to solve business problems. - Product Development: Oversee the end-to-end development of our SaaS platform, ensuring code quality, security, and performance across both the frontend and backend. - Project Orchestration: Work closely with the Product Manager to prioritize tasks, manage technical debt, and ensure timely delivery of features. - Culture & Collaboration: Maintain a low-ego, team-first mentality. We value problem-solvers who prioritize the success of the product and the team over personal accolades.
Job Requirements
- Technical Skills Requirements:
- Full Stack Mastery (TypeScript): Extensive experience building scalable applications using TypeScript on both the frontend and backend.
- Node.js Expert: Minimum of 5 years of experience with the Node.js engine, specifically using frameworks like FastifyJS or NestJS for robust backend services.
- Frontend Proficiency: Deep expertise in ReactJS and Next.js to create seamless, high-performance user interfaces.
- Communication & Telephony (Twilio): At least 2 years of hands-on experience integrating Twilio APIs for voice, SMS, or automation workflows.
- API Design: Proven track record of designing clean, maintainable, and secure RESTful APIs that can handle complex data flows.
- DevOps & Deployment: Professional experience working with Docker and containerized environments to ensure consistent application performance across different stages.
- Payments & Third-Party Integrations: Experience implementing Stripe for SaaS subscription billing and managing Zapier developer integrations for workflow automation.
- Problem-Solving Mindset: Ability to troubleshoot complex system bottlenecks and find elegant solutions to technical hurdles.
- Prompt Engineering & Orchestration: Proven ability to design effective prompts and use orchestration frameworks (like LangChain or LlamaIndex) to build complex, multi-step AI workflows.
